Is a turboprop better than a turbofan?
In fact, turboprop engines are also more efficient than turbofan engines, but aircraft speeds using turboprop engines are typically lower than those of turbofan engines. Planes with turboprop engines are typically limited to a lower cruising altitude than jet engines, capping at around 25,000-30,000 feet. Because of this, turboprops are also more susceptible to turbulence, noise, and inclement weather.In contrast to turbofans, turboprops are most efficient at flight speeds below 725 km/h (450 mph; 390 knots) because the jet velocity of the propeller (and exhaust) is relatively low.Turboprops are designed to fly at lower altitudes than jets, making turboprop aircraft less recommended for bad weather. A turboprop is more prone to be influenced by weather and turbulence at the lower altitude it flies at. In comparison, a jet can cruise casually through rougher weather at a higher altitude.

Why do airlines use turbofans rather than turbojets?
Turbofans are the dominant engine type for medium and long-range airliners. Turbofans are usually more efficient than turbojets at subsonic speeds, but at high speeds their large frontal area generates more drag. Low bypass ratio turbofans are still more fuel efficient than basic turbojets. Many modern fighter planes actually use low bypass ratio turbofans equipped with afterburners. They can then cruise efficiently but still have high thrust when dogfighting.
